Output 24ecbb36237b582a09b3ec258f37b01c0fecd78f82d1edd0d8cf80936c6b1d7d:25

value
12768877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a57f707713af0108867ff8c0a8d1d2c19a6640 OP_EQUAL
address
3Md7VMP4jctH23Qj8p88pV6GHzzpb3RWxr
transaction
24ecbb36237b582a09b3ec258f37b01c0fecd78f82d1edd0d8cf80936c6b1d7d
spent
true